    Ramaphosa labels US attacks on South Africa “misinformation”

    Ramaphosa mentioned in a televised handle the explanations the US gave for its “non-participation” have been knowledgeable by “baseless and false allegations that South Africa is perpetrating genocide in opposition to Afrikaners and the confiscation of land from white individuals”.

    “That is blatant misinformation about our nation,” the president mentioned on the SABC broadcast. 

    “As a rustic, we’re conscious that the stance taken by the US administration has been influenced by a sustained marketing campaign of disinformation by teams and people inside our nation, within the US and elsewhere.

    “These people who find themselves spreading disinformation are endangering and undermining South Africa’s nationwide pursuits, destroying South African jobs and weakening our nation’s relations with certainly one of our most necessary companions.”

    Ramaphosa nonetheless mentioned South Africa was keen “to proceed to interact in dialogue with the USA authorities, and to take action with respect and with dignity as equal sovereign nations”.
